GENERAL DESCRIPTION
The AD80066 is a complete analog signal processor for imaging applications. It features a 4-channel architecture designed to sample and condition the outputs of linear charged coupled device (CCD) or contact image sensor (CIS) arrays. Each channel consists of an input clamp, correlated double sampler (CDS), offset digital-to-analog converter (DAC), and programmable gain amplifier (PGA), multiplexed to a high performance 16-bit ADC. For maximum flexibility, the AD80066 can be configured as a 4-channel, 3-channel, 2-channel, or 1-channel device.
FEATURES
16-bit, 24 MSPS analog-to-digital converter (ADC)
4-channel operation up to 24 MHz (6 MHz/channel)
3-channel operation up to 24 MHz (8 MHz/channel)
Selectable input range: 3 V or 1.5 V peak-to-peak
Input clamp circuitry
Correlated double sampling
1×~6× programmable gain
±300 mV programmable offset
Internal voltage reference
Multiplexed byte-wide output
Optional single-byte output mode
3-wire serial digital interface
3 V/5 V digital I/O compatibility
Power dissipation: 490 mW at 24 MHz operation
Reduced power mode and sleep mode available
28-lead SSOP package
APPLICATIONS
Flatbed document scanners
Film scanners
Digital color copiers
Multifunction peripherals
